Oxter Posted December 23, 2016 Share May I ask what device you are using for swimming. I have recently yanked out my old Polar 725x for this purpose- BUT the watch does not pick HR from the transmitter whilst the latter is under water. I have to stand up between laps for it to see heart rate. The result is that I am still only getting 100 points for the gym swipe.Fenix 3...has a swim HR monitor, but it basically records your HR during your training session and transfers the data as soon as you are finished (and out of the water). The problem with swimming is there is only one or two watches on the market that will give you a live HR while swimming, and only a few more that can record your HR while swimming. Edit:if you swim longer than 30min you will get 100 points for speed data only hehe. Sounds better than just a gym swipe, but the same effect.
